Catherine Connolly (Galway West, Independent)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
324. To ask the Minister for Health the engagement he has had with the Saolta University Health Care Group and the HSE in relation to the ongoing failure to provide operating theatres at Merlin Park Hospital, Galway since the closure in September 2017 of two operating theatres;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[15177/19]
Simon Harris (Wicklow,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
Officials from my Department have ongoing engagement with Saolta University Health Care Group and the HSE in relation to a range of issues including the tender process for the provision of 2 modular theatres for Orthopaedics on the Merlin Park University Hospital site.
Saolta University Health Care Group advise that they are working towards restoring the full elective orthopaedic service as quickly as possible.
